Continuous landslides on the Mang River dyke, the risk of further expansion

HOÀNG LỘC |

Vinh Long - Many landslide points continuously appear on the Mang River dyke line through Tan Long Hoi commune, with locations deep into the mainland, cracking the foundation of people's houses.
